Masked
Palestinian policemen point their AK-47
machine-guns during training in the
West Bank city of Hebron, February 5,
2005. Israel approved a troop pullback
from West Bank cities and the release
of 900 Palestinian prisoners, measures
crucial to the success of a summit with
the Palestinians in Egypt next week

A
video image shows men arrested by Iraqi
security forces on February 1, 2005,
suspected of being involved in a series
of recent attacks in the capital Baghdad.
The men were caught during a crackdown
launched by Iraqi forces and the multi-national
forces aimed at reducing attacks during
Sunday's election. The Iraqi forces
also confiscated scores of weapons and
explosives, including 20 AK-47s, dozens
of mortar rounds and hundreds of detonator
caps, automatic machine guns and rocket-propelled
grenades.

A
security guard holds an AK-47 rifle
outside the Sheikh Abdul Qadir Mosque
as a young girl looks out from behind
a curtain during Friday prayers in Baghdad,
February 4, 2005. Witnesses said masked
men planted explosives around the building
early in the morning then blew it up.
No one was injured in the blast.

A
mourner shoots an AK-47 into the air
at the funeral for two Iraqi journalists
killed in twin suicide bomb attacks
in Baghdad April 15, 2005. Iraqi Kurdish
al-Hurriyah TV cameraman Ali Ibrahim
and news coordinator Fadil Hazim were
killed whilst Awwad al-Rikabi was seriously
injured in the attack which left at
least 15 people dead on Thursday.

Malalai
Badahari and Habiba Sultani

Malalai
Badahari (left) with her colleague Habiba
Sultani at police headquarters in Kabul.
By day Malalai Badahari wears dark glasses,
combat fatigues and wields an AK-47.
But at dusk the diminutive counter-narcotics
cop slips her veil back on her head
and goes back to her home life, where
all her neighbours think she is a teacher.
